LOCAL STUDENTS SHINE AT BC WIDE MATH COMPETITION

June 11, 2013 - 4:53am

Students from Nanaimo’s Dover Bay Secondary School and Wellington Secondary School won the final round in of the 19th annual 2013 BC Secondary School Math Contest (Mid-Island region) held at Vancouver Island University (VIU) recently.


This year’s BC Secondary School Math Contest was sponsored by VIU, School District # 68 (Nanaimo-Ladysmith) and the Canadian Mathematical Society. The annual contest is organized by a committee made up of math faculty from 11 different BC colleges and universities including VIU.

Each college or university is responsible for holding a preliminary round of competitions within their own school districts in April. Winners compete in the final round at colleges and universities in May. Each round is further divided into two divisions: the junior division for grades 8 to 10 and the senior division for grades 11 and 12.


Five hundred students participated in the preliminary round of this year's contest (15 multiple choice questions with a 45 minute time limit) and the top nine students from each school were invited to participate in the final round.


A total of 84 math students: 45 juniors and 39 seniors from eleven schools in the Nanaimo-Ladysmith and Qualicum school districts attended the final round of the contest at VIU. Each student had to answer 10 multiple choice questions and five written questions in two hours. The top three students from each division received a $50 prize and the top school in each division received the coveted Pi Cup.


The day's activities included the contest in the morning, followed by lunch and an entertaining talk by the VIU math department professor Dr. Cobus Swarts in the afternoon. Here is a list of this year's winners:
